Belmont Hill School Inc. (EIN: 04-2103870)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2024. In its fiscal year 2020 IRS Form 990 filing, Belmont Hill School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 8 out of 271 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$295,247. The highest compensated employee at Belmont Hill School Inc. is Gregory Schneider with fiscal year 2020 compensation of $608,947.

Mission Statement

Belmont Hill School educates boys in mind, body, and spirit to develop men of good character. Our community encourages and challenges students to discover and pursue passions, seek excellence and face adversity with resilience. We cultivate critical thinking and creativity, teamwork and competition, hard work and reflections, tradition and innovation. Valuing our differences and working together, we embrace camaraderie, compassion, and service to others. Our school strives to instill in each boy ethical judgment, a sense of common humanity, and lifelong love of learning.
